According to their �Help � page:
Due to various licensing agreements, a small number of videos cannot be viewed or downloaded by users outside the UK. We determine whether you are based in the UK or not through your IP address. This is designated to you by your internet service provider (ISP) each time you go online.
So, in theory at least, there should be many videos that you can download! But also it means that you can �t just masquerade as a Brit unless you can change your IP Address to a UK code.
